		<description>yea of course you can.
theres alternate disks you can buy at most shops and some of the bindings even come with it. my burton cartels came with both disk options. 
any burton binding will go onto any board except the burton EST bindings. they can only go on select burton boards.&lt;br&gt;&lt;b&gt;References : &lt;/b&gt;&lt;br&gt;</description>
